Infinite square-free self-shuffling words

Published 25 Jan 2014 in cs.DM, cs.FL, and math.CO | (1401.6536v2)

Abstract: In this paper we answer two recent questions from Charlier et al. and Harju about self-shuffling words. An infinite word $w$ is called self-shuffling, if $w=\prod_{i=0}\infty U_iV_i=\prod_{i=0}\infty U_i=\prod_{i=0}\infty V_i$ for some finite words $U_i$, $V_i$. Harju recently asked whether square-free self-shuffling words exist. We answer this question affirmatively. Besides that, we build an infinite word such that no word in its shift orbit closure is self-shuffling, answering positively a question from Charlier et al.
